Overview

Gasoline and naphtha testing is a critical quality control process in the petroleum industry, ensuring products meet specifications for combustion performance, environmental regulations, and end-user safety. These tests analyze hydrocarbon composition, additives, and contaminants across the supply chain—from refinery output to retail distribution. Standardized testing methods (e.g., ASTM D4814 for gasoline, ASTM D86 for distillation) are universally adopted. Modern labs combine traditional techniques like gas chromatography with advanced spectrometry to detect ppm-level impurities, reflecting tightening global standards such as Euro 5/6 and Tier 3 emissions regulations.

Physical and Chemical Properties

Key tested parameters include distillation characteristics (T10-T90 points), vapor pressure (Reid Method), octane rating (RON/MON), and sulfur content (ASTM D5453). Naphtha testing additionally focuses on paraffin/olefin/aromatic (PONA) composition and naphthene percentages for petrochemical feedstock suitability. Density (ASTM D4052) and viscosity measurements ensure proper fuel metering and atomization. Stability tests like gum content (ASTM D381) predict storage performance, while corrosion tests (Copper Strip) assess equipment compatibility. Modern analyzers can complete 20+ parameters in under 30 minutes through automated multi-test platforms.

Main Applications

Refineries conduct in-process testing to optimize blending operations and meet regional fuel specs (e.g., 95 RON in EU vs. 87 AKI in US). Pipeline operators test for contamination during transportation, while terminals verify additive dosing (detergents, oxygenates) before retail distribution. Environmental agencies mandate testing for benzene (<1% vol), sulfur (<10 ppm), and MTBE content. Specialized applications include aviation gasoline (Avgas 100LL) testing for lead content and marine naphtha analysis for solvent properties in paint/varnish manufacturing.

Safety and Storage

Testing laboratories require Class I, Division 1 hazardous area classifications for equipment. Proper grounding prevents static ignition during sample transfer, while explosion-proof refrigerators store samples below flash points (-40°C for winter gasoline blends). Personnel handling leaded gasoline or high-aromatic naphtha must use respirators (OSHA 1910.134) and monitor VOC exposure. Waste samples are treated as hazardous materials—common disposal methods include incineration with energy recovery or approved solvent recycling processes.

B2B Procurement Guide

When selecting testing services, prioritize labs with ISO 17025 accreditation and API-certified personnel. Mobile testing units (ASTM D7975) provide on-site results for time-sensitive operations like ship loading. For routine quality control, consider subscription models covering 100+ tests annually at discounted rates. Essential procurement considerations include method validation reports (especially for alternative ASTM/EN/JP standards equivalency), data integrity (21 CFR Part 11 compliance for electronic records), and proficiency testing participation (e.g., ASTM D02 Interlaboratory Crosscheck Program). Leading providers offer LIMS integration for automated report generation.
